Dave Phillips wrote:
When using convert-ly you should add this line to your original LY file:
\version "1.8"
Well, you should add the version number of the LilyPond version the
file originally was written for. Typically, it has three level of
digits, such as \version "1.8.3".
since the utility essentially works as an updating device.
Also, how is it decided which versions are ported to Windows?
I don't use Windows and I'm not a LilyPond developer, but my guess is
that there's a big dartboard at LilyPond Central... ;-)
The stable versions (2.2.x for the moment) are ported to Windows as
quickly as the responsible person has time to do it. The experimental
development versions (2.3.x for the moment) are typically not ported.
